Richard Burton, 82, of Rose City

Richard Lee Burton Sr., age 82, passed away on Sunday, February 27, 2022 at his home in Rose City, MI surrounded by his loving family. He was born on July 12, 1939 in West Branch, MI to Willard and Beatrice (Matthews) Burton.

Dick married Ruth Garnett in Waterford, MI on June 25, 1960. He lived in Rose City since 1995 formerly of Highland, MI.
Dick served in the United States Navy from 1959 – 1963. He was aboard the USS Independence and was very proud to serve in the U.S. Navy. He traveled to France, Spain, Italy, Azores, Newfoundland, Greece, Turkey, Cuba, Bay of Pigs in 1961, and Cuban Missile Crisis in 1962. He was a member of the VFW and enjoyed hunting, woodworking, and puzzles.

Dick is survived by his beloved wife of 61 years, Ruth Burton; son, Richard Burton Jr.; daughters, Laura (Bill) Barron and Tina (Mike) Bond; grandchildren, Emilly (Jake) Roche, Tyler Martin, Christopher (Lauren) Bond and Heidi Martin; great granddaughter, Harper Bond and one great granddaughter and one great grandson expected; and many nieces, nephews, beloved brothers-in-law, sisters-in-law, cousins, and close family friends.

He is preceded in death by his parents and brother Willard II.

Visitation will be at Steuernol & McLaren Funeral Home in Rose City on Sunday, March 6, 2022 starting at 11:00 a.m. until the time of the funeral service at 2:00 p.m. The Ogemaw County Veteran Alliance will provide the veteran honors.
